Screen recording retention can be set at the client level.

Client-Level Retention Settings 

To view Retention Settings at the Client Level:

  1. Navigate to Configure > Services > Client > Settings tab.
  2. The Retention Settings section of the window displays the following information related to call recording:
    1. Days of Screen Recordings - View-only option. It displays the number of days for which a call recording is available. The minimum retention period available to store call recordings is 3 days. The available options are 3, 15, 30, 45, 60, 90, 180, and 365. 

Screen Recording Settings

The Screen Recording control options are available only if Screen Recording is enabled. Contact the Customer Support team to enable the option.

To configure the screen recording controls:

  1. Navigate to Configure > Agents Agent Desktop.
  2. Double-click on the Agent Desktop you want to configure and click the General tab.
  3. The following options are available that you can configure:
    1. Screen Recording Control Enabled: Check this option to allow agents to pause/resume or stop screen recording by using call recording control buttons.
    2. Screen Recording Control Percentage: Set the percentage of calls to be screen recorded in this field.

To configure the Screen Recording options available in the Agent Desktop:

  1. Navigate to Configure > Agents Agent Desktop.
  2. Double-click on the Agent Desktop you want to configure and click the Desktop Native tab.
  3. Set the following fields:
    1. Screen Recording: Check this option to record the agent screen. Multiple monitors are also captured in the screen recording.
    2. Format: Screen recordings are processed in WebM format.
    3. Bitrate (kbps): Number of bits that are conveyed per unit of time. Available options are 128, 256, 512, and 1024. The default setting is 128.
    4. Framerate (FPS): Number of frames displayed per second for a video. Available options are 10, 20, and 30. The default setting is 30.
    5. Days of Screen Recordings: Number of days the screen recordings are hosted on LiveVox. Available options are 3, 15, 30, 45, 60, 90, and 180.

      Contact your Account Manager for information on storage fees.

Screen Recording File Specifications

Screen recording file type is the webm format (For example, myrecording.webm). The codec and coder used by LiveVox to generate the screen recording webm files are the following:

  • Framerate (FPS): Available Options are 10, 20, and 30. The default setting is 30.
  • Bitrate(kbps): Available Options are 128, 256, 512, and 1024. The default setting is 128.
  • Codec: VP8
  • Library: Chromium
